Paralegal Hourly Pay in Owasso, OK: $27.12 (2026)
Quick Answer:Hourly pay for a paralegal working in Owasso, OK runs $27.12 at the median for 2026 — annualizing to $56,416 at a standard 2,080-hour year. Figures proj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 23-2011). Weighted against Owasso's regional price level (BEA RPP 88.9, 11% below national), each hour of work buys what $30.51 nationally would. A 24-hour part-time schedule grosses $33,845 per year.

Paralegal Hourly Wage Breakdown
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Per 8hr Shift |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$19.10 | $152.78 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$21.25 | $170.00 |
| Median (P50) | $27.12 | $216.96 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$33.70 | $269.62 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$41.76 | $334.05 |

Hourly Rate Trajectory for Paralegals in Owasso (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 3.51% projection.
| Year | Hourly Rate |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$21.55/hr | Actual |
| 2020 | $22.05/hr | Actual |
| 2021 | $23.43/hr | Actual |
| 2022 | $24.66/hr | Actual |
| 2023 | $25.40/hr | Actual |
| 2024 | $20.83/hr | Actual |
| 2025 | $26.20/hr |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$27.12/hr | Estimated |
| 2027 | $28.07/hr |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, the median hourly rate for paralegals in Owasso grew 21.6% from $21.55/hr (2019) to $26.20/hr (2025). At a 3.51% projected growth rate, hourly pay is expected to reach $28.07/hr by 2027. Part-time and per-diem paralegals can use this multi-year trend to benchmark future contract negotiations.
